This engaging and energetic class introduces students to the dynamic world of musical theatre dance. Designed for beginners, the class focuses on building a strong foundation in dance techniques commonly used in Broadway-style performances, including jazz, ballet, and character work.

Each session includes a warm-up, choreography practice, and time for creative expression. By the end of the course, students will have the confidence to perform a short routine inspired by a classic or contemporary musical theatre number. No prior dance experience is required. NOTE: Comfortable clothing and dance shoes (jazz shoes or sneakers) are recommended.
